>>Craig Lee Hare used Internet auction houses eBay Inc. (Nasdaq:EBAY - news) and Up4Sale to advertise new and used computers, attracting bids of as much as $2,700 each, but never delivered the goods or issued refunds.

Hare was sentenced by the U.S. District Court in Southern District of Florida last Friday to six months home detention and three years probation and was ordered to pay restitution of over $22,000.<<

Man sentenced for fraud on online auction site

NEW YORK, Feb 18 (Reuters) - An online merchant in Florida has been convicted of wire fraud, highlighting growing concerns about this kind of crime on Internet auction sites, the U.S. Federal Trade Commission said on Thursday.
